Re: [PATCH net-next 2/6] tools/lib/bpf: add support for BPF_PROG_TEST_RUN command

On 2017/3/31 9:31, Alexei Starovoitov wrote:
quoted hunk ↗ jump to hunk
add support for BPF_PROG_TEST_RUN command to libbpf.a

Signed-off-by: Alexei Starovoitov <ast@kernel.org>
Acked-by: Daniel Borkmann <daniel@iogearbox.net>
Acked-by: Martin KaFai Lau <redacted>
---
  tools/include/uapi/linux/bpf.h | 24 ++++++++++++++++++++++++
  tools/lib/bpf/bpf.c            | 24 ++++++++++++++++++++++++
  tools/lib/bpf/bpf.h            |  4 +++-
  3 files changed, 51 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/tools/include/uapi/linux/bpf.h b/tools/include/uapi/linux/bpf.h
index 1ea08ce35567..a1d95386f562 100644
--- a/tools/include/uapi/linux/bpf.h
+++ b/tools/include/uapi/linux/bpf.h
@@ -81,6 +81,7 @@ enum bpf_cmd {
  	BPF_OBJ_GET,
  	BPF_PROG_ATTACH,
  	BPF_PROG_DETACH,
+	BPF_PROG_TEST_RUN,
  };
  
  enum bpf_map_type {
@@ -189,6 +190,17 @@ union bpf_attr {
  		__u32		attach_type;
  		__u32		attach_flags;
  	};
+
+	struct { /* anonymous struct used by BPF_PROG_TEST_RUN command */
+		__u32		prog_fd;
+		__u32		retval;
+		__u32		data_size_in;
+		__u32		data_size_out;
+		__aligned_u64	data_in;
+		__aligned_u64	data_out;
+		__u32		repeat;
+		__u32		duration;
+	} test;
  } __attribute__((aligned(8)));
  
  /* BPF helper function descriptions:
@@ -459,6 +471,18 @@ union bpf_attr {
   *     Return:
   *       > 0 length of the string including the trailing NUL on success
   *       < 0 error
+ *
+ * u64 bpf_bpf_get_socket_cookie(skb)
+ *     Get the cookie for the socket stored inside sk_buff.
+ *     @skb: pointer to skb
+ *     Return: 8 Bytes non-decreasing number on success or 0 if the socket
+ *     field is missing inside sk_buff
+ *
+ * u32 bpf_get_socket_uid(skb)
+ *     Get the owner uid of the socket stored inside sk_buff.
+ *     @skb: pointer to skb
+ *     Return: uid of the socket owner on success or 0 if the socket pointer
+ *     inside sk_buff is NULL
   */
  #define __BPF_FUNC_MAPPER(FN)		\
  	FN(unspec),			\
diff --git a/tools/lib/bpf/bpf.c b/tools/lib/bpf/bpf.c
index 9b58d20e8c93..b5ca5277e30c 100644
--- a/tools/lib/bpf/bpf.c
+++ b/tools/lib/bpf/bpf.c
@@ -209,3 +209,27 @@ int bpf_prog_detach(int target_fd, enum bpf_attach_type type)
  
  	return sys_bpf(BPF_PROG_DETACH, &attr, sizeof(attr));
  }
+
+int bpf_program_test_run(int prog_fd, int repeat, void *data, __u32 size,
+			 void *data_out, __u32 *size_out, __u32 *retval,
+			 __u32 *duration)
+{
+	union bpf_attr attr;
+	int ret;
+
+	bzero(&attr, sizeof(attr));
+	attr.test.prog_fd = prog_fd;
+	attr.test.data_in = ptr_to_u64(data);
+	attr.test.data_out = ptr_to_u64(data_out);
+	attr.test.data_size_in = size;
+	attr.test.repeat = repeat;
+
+	ret = sys_bpf(BPF_PROG_TEST_RUN, &attr, sizeof(attr));
+	if (size_out)
+		*size_out = attr.test.data_size_out;
+	if (retval)
+		*retval = attr.test.retval;
+	if (duration)
+		*duration = attr.test.duration;
+	return ret;
+}
diff --git a/tools/lib/bpf/bpf.h b/tools/lib/bpf/bpf.h
index 93f021932623..adfb320ff21d 100644
--- a/tools/lib/bpf/bpf.h
+++ b/tools/lib/bpf/bpf.h
@@ -47,6 +47,8 @@ int bpf_obj_get(const char *pathname);
  int bpf_prog_attach(int prog_fd, int attachable_fd, enum bpf_attach_type type,
  		    unsigned int flags);
  int bpf_prog_detach(int attachable_fd, enum bpf_attach_type type);
-
+int bpf_program_test_run(int prog_fd, int repeat, void *data, __u32 size,
+			 void *data_out, __u32 *size_out, __u32 *retval,
+			 __u32 *duration);
  
Please call it bpf_prog_test_run() so it looks uniform with others.

Thank you.
